The Inc. 5000 is ranked according to percentage revenue growth when comparing 2011 to 2014. Qualifying companies must have been founded and generating revenue by March 31, 2011. Only U.S.-based, privately held, for profit, and independent companies as of December 31, 2014 were considered.
